
Acrux Cyber Services, established in 2015, is a Lithuanian-based SME specializing in research and development of artificial intelligence (AI) solutions. Initially focused on cybersecurity, the company has expanded its expertise to include natural language processing, recommender systems, and computer vision. Acrux has a proven track record in applying AI across various sectors, including military applications, healthcare, retail, and signal analysis. The multidisciplinary team comprises AI experts, electronics engineers, and software developers, ensuring comprehensive solutions tailored to client needs. Notably, the company is an alumnus of Plug and Play’s Munich accelerator program, underscoring its commitment to innovation and excellence. Acrux has also participated in multiple EU-funded projects, providing extensive R&D services to various companies.

Jokūbas Drazdas
Jokūbas Drazdas is a researcher and innovator specializing in artificial intelligence (AI) and cybersecurity. With over a decade of experience in the IT sector, he has developed AI solutions for various industries, including healthcare, military applications, and signal analysis.
As the CEO of UAB Acrux Cyber Service, Jokūbas led the creation of an AI system that assists medical staff in monitoring patients on artificial lung ventilation devices. This system has been utilized at Vilnius University Hospital, demonstrating his commitment to applying AI for societal benefit.
Jokūbas is an alumnus of the Plug and Play accelerator, known for supporting innovation creators. His work has been recognized by global corporations and was nominated to represent Lithuania in the health innovation category at the United Nations-backed World Summit Awards.
Beyond his research and development work, Jokūbas participates in discussions on AI and cybersecurity, mentors technology startups, and attends various technology conferences in Lithuania and internationally. Artūras Serackis
Artūras Serackis is a head of the Department of Electronic Systems at VILNIUS TECH. He received his Bachelor diploma of Electronics Engineering in 2002, MSc of Electronics Engineering in 2004 and doctor of Electrical and Electronics Engineering degree in 2008 at VILNIUS TECH. In 2012 he received an Assoc. Professor title and in 2017, Professor title at VILNIUS TECH. He was a member of organizing committee in various international conferences, such as NORCHIP, EMD, ICDIPC, MIKON, SPS. Main research interests include real-time image and signal processing, development and application of intelligent systems. He has published more than 70 papers in reviewed journals and conference proceedings, a monograph in the field of intelligent electronic systems and two textbooks. A. Serackis has successfully finished 10 research and development projects, was a supervisor of four successfully defended PhD thesis, currently supervising four PhD students, is a Senior member of IEEE and is a Chair of IEEE Lithuania Section Signal Processing Society/Computational intelligence Society/Communication Society joint chapter. A. Serackis is a chair of VILNIUS TECH and SRI FTMC Doctoral Committee for Scientific Field of Electrical and Electronic Engineering.
